Rethink Commerce Blog

About Stefan Verbaarschott

 Director, Payments Compliance in Legal at 2Checkout

Check out his latest articles

What is PSD2 and What Does Strong Customer Authentication (SCA) Mean for You?

Posted on August 1st, 2019 by

Initially introduced in January 2018, the Payment Services Directive 2 (PSD2) has by now taken effect in the entire European Union in the local legislation. […]